The Mechanics of the Continuous Price: How AI-Driven 'Offers and Orders' Reshapes Global Airline Retailing

The aviation industry is dismantling its 40-year-old ticketing architecture in favor of dynamic, AI-driven retail systems. This shift replaces rigid fare classes with continuous pricing, fundamentally changing how flights are bought, priced, and bundled.

Why it matters

For decades, travelers have watched flight prices jump arbitrarily when a rigid 'fare bucket' empties. The shift to continuous pricing eliminates these sudden cliffs, offering a smoother, more personalized shopping experience where you only pay for the exact bundle of services you want.

You have likely experienced the frustration of the sudden fare jump. You search for a flight to Paris or Tokyo, see a reasonable price, and pause to confirm your hotel. When you refresh the page an hour later, the flight costs $150 more. The airline did not suddenly experience a surge of demand in those sixty minutes; rather, you simply bought the first ticket in a new, arbitrary pricing bucket.

That frustrating digital staircase is finally being dismantled. A sweeping industry transformation known as 'Offers and Orders' is replacing the 40-year-old architecture of airline ticketing with modern, AI-driven retail systems. At the heart of this shift is a mechanism called continuous pricing, which allows airfares to float smoothly based on real-time context rather than snapping between rigid, pre-set tiers.[1][4]

To understand why this matters, you have to look at the invisible machinery that has governed air travel since the 1980s. Historically, airlines sold 'tickets' tied to a Passenger Name Record (PNR) and a specific Reservation Booking Designator (RBD). These RBDs are the 26 letters of the alphabet, each representing a fixed price bucket and inventory level for a seat on the plane.[4][5]

When the 'L' class bucket sells out, the system automatically jumps to the 'M' class bucket. There is no middle-ground ticket available, even if a price squarely between the two would perfectly match the current market demand. The system is a rigid staircase, creating artificial scarcity and sudden price cliffs that punish travelers who happen to cross the threshold between two letters.[3][5]

Continuous pricing, powered by advanced artificial intelligence, eliminates these 26 discrete buckets. Instead of a staircase, the pricing model becomes a smooth curve. The AI evaluates real-time demand, competitor pricing, and the specific context of the search to generate an exact price point that balances the airline's revenue goals with the traveler's willingness to pay.[2][3]

This is no longer just a theoretical whitepaper concept. In July 2026, Scandinavian Airlines (SAS) rolled out Amadeus Air Pricing Optimization across its entire network, moving continuous pricing out of pilot testing and into standard commercial operation. The system allows the carrier to adjust fares smoothly without the manual intervention previously required to refile fares across global distribution systems.[3]

For the airlines, the financial incentive to adopt this technology is massive. Carriers using AI pricing optimization report an average revenue increase of 3 to 5 percent. When applied across the global aviation industry, the shift to modern retailing and continuous pricing is projected to unlock up to $40 billion to $45 billion in new value by 2030.[2][5]

But continuous pricing is only half of the equation. The broader 'Offers and Orders' framework fundamentally changes what you are actually buying. In the legacy system, you bought a seat, and any extras were clunky add-ons bolted onto the PNR. In the new model, the airline's Offer Management System constructs a personalized 'Offer' in real time.[1][5]

AI-driven offer management systems evaluate real-time context to construct personalized travel bundles.

This is where the travel experience becomes highly tailored, particularly for food and lifestyle preferences. Because the system can dynamically bundle services, an airline can offer a culinary-focused traveler a specific package that includes premium inflight dining, priority boarding, and a pass to a partner restaurant in the terminal, all priced as a single, cohesive offer rather than a disjointed list of fees.

Once you accept this tailored bundle, it becomes an 'Order.' The Order Management System tracks this purchase exactly like a modern e-commerce shopping cart. If your flight is delayed or you need to rebook, the entire order—including your specific meal request and lounge access—moves seamlessly with you. In the old PNR system, these ancillary services frequently decoupled during disruptions, leaving passengers fighting for refunds at the gate.[1][5]

Despite the clear benefits of a smoother shopping experience, the transition to AI-driven pricing introduces new uncertainties. Consumer advocates worry that contextual pricing could edge into personalized price discrimination, where the AI quotes a higher fare simply because it recognizes a user as a business traveler booking a last-minute trip.

Technology providers emphasize that their systems operate within strict airline-defined guardrails and strategies, rather than acting as unsupervised black boxes. The goal is to match price to broad demand and context, not to exploit individual user data. However, as these algorithms grow more sophisticated, the line between smart yield management and opaque pricing will require careful industry navigation.[3]

Key terms

Continuous Pricing
A dynamic pricing method that generates fluid, real-time airfares based on demand, eliminating the need for rigid, pre-set price tiers.
Reservation Booking Designator (RBD)
The legacy system of 26 letters used by airlines to categorize fixed price buckets and inventory for a flight.
Passenger Name Record (PNR)
A traditional digital file in a computer reservation system that contains the itinerary for a passenger, which is being phased out by modern Order systems.
Offer Management System (OMS)
The modern software engine that allows airlines to dynamically construct and price personalized bundles of flights and ancillary services in real time.

Reader questions

What exactly is continuous pricing?

Continuous pricing is an AI-driven model that allows airlines to offer an unlimited number of price points based on real-time demand, rather than restricting fares to a set of 26 fixed price buckets.

Will this make flights more expensive?

Not necessarily. While it helps airlines maximize revenue on peak flights, it also prevents the sudden, massive price jumps that occur in the legacy system when a lower-priced bucket sells out, potentially saving money for mid-demand travelers.

What does 'Offers and Orders' mean?

It is an industry initiative to replace traditional tickets with a modern retail system. An 'Offer' is a customized bundle of flight and services, and an 'Order' is the digital shopping cart that tracks your purchase, making it easier to manage changes and refunds.
